What are Pulseras Electrónicas para Festivales?
Pulseras electrónicas, or electronic wristbands, are wearable devices embedded with NFC technology, designed to streamline various aspects of event management. These wristbands serve multiple purposes, including access control, cashless payments, and real-time attendance tracking. By replacing traditional tickets, these wristbands eliminate the need for physical tickets and cash transactions, offering a user-friendly alternative that enhances the overall event experience.
How NFC Works in Event Management
NFC technology operates by enabling communication between two devices when they are brought into proximity, typically within a few centimeters. In event settings, this means that attendees can simply tap their wristband at designated reader points to gain entry, make purchases, or check in at various locations throughout the venue. This instant exchange of information not only speeds up processes significantly but also reduces the risks associated with counterfeit tickets and fraud.

Streamlined Entry Processes for Large Events
Managing the entry process for thousands of attendees can be challenging. Traditional methods often lead to long queues and dissatisfaction among guests. Smart wristbands equipped with NFC technology revolutionize this experience by allowing rapid scanning at entry points. This technology can process more than 2,000 entries per hour without delays, ensuring that guests can access the event without unnecessary wait times.
Real-Time Monitoring of Crowds
One of the significant advantages of utilizing NFC wristbands is the capability for real-time crowd monitoring. Organizers can track the flow of attendees across various zones of the event, enabling quick adjustments to manage density and enhance safety. This data-driven approach helps in making informed decisions that improve the overall event experience.

Planning for Scalability: RFID vs. NFC
While both RFID (Radio Frequency Identification) and NFC are valuable technologies, they serve different needs. RFID is typically better suited for larger-scale tracking, such as inventory management, while NFC is ideal for event access control and direct transactions. Understanding these differences helps organizers choose the right technology based on their specific event requirements.
